2017-04-16 6 views
1

サブプロジェクトを持つVSTSでホストされているgitリポジトリにUnityプロジェクトがあります.GitリポジトリとUnityクラウドビルドを統合しました。gitサブモジュールでクラウドビルドに失敗する

クラウドビルドがビルドを行うときに、モジュールに到達するまですべてをチェックしているようですが、 '328:Assets/MySubmodule'へのクローン...という行にハングアップしています。時間がかかりすぎるとビルドが失敗する1時間前に「https://mycompany.visualstudio.com 『の

ユーザー名::

私はエラーが時々それはようになり得る』 https://mycompany.visualstudio.com/DefaultCollection/_git/mysubmodulerepopath」のクローンをサブモジュールパス「資産/ mysubmodule」内には、私は問題があることかもしれないと思ってい

を失敗しましたサブモジュールはsshリンクとして参照されているわけではなく、直接httpsとして参照されていますが、動作させるには何らかの回避策が必要ですか?

答えて

1

は片道確かであるSSH

+0

を使用するようにサブモジュールのgitのURLを更新することでこの問題を修正し、再びあなたのレポのクローンを作成します。 +1私のソリューションは、追跡されたファイルの変更を伴わなかった。 – VonC

1

私は問題はサブモジュールはその後、SSHを使用して、もう一度、この時間をクローニングすることができますsshのリンクとしてではなく、直接のhttps

として参照されていないことであるかもしれないと思っています。
まず、タイプ:

git config --global url."[email protected]:".insteadOf "https://github.com/" 

その後(git clone --recursive

関連する問題